The Splintr crash-report pipeline in prod is not matching what's in the deploy manifest. Symbolication workers are running with a larger batch size than declared, and the dedup window appears to have been shortened manually, probably during the incident two weeks ago. Result: intermittent duplicate crash groups and slower symbol lookups during peak upload hours. On-call should not restart workers until we reconcile, since a restart will silently revert the live settings. The running values, dumped from the active workers, are below.

settings of bawif-fawif:
ralix:
  log_level: warn
  metrics_host: metrics.ralix.tolvaqsys.internal
  pool_size: 32

## v3.8.1 — Dispatch Core (Fleetwise)

Reworked the driver-assignment heuristic. Proximity weight dropped from 0.7 to 0.5; shift-remaining time now factored in. Stale-location fallback removed — assignments fail fast instead. Contractors: don't touch `assign_score()` without reading the design note in the repo wiki first. Regressions here page the whole dispatch rotation. Questions on the heuristic go to the owner listed below.

account owner for bawip-fajeg: Ralix Oliwyn

## Tuning

The GateTally counter at Harwick Arena debounces turnstile pulses so one enthusiastic shove doesn't count as three fans. For security review purposes: the debounce window, the anomaly threshold that flags tailgating, and the rollover alarm are all configurable, but we ship opinionated defaults that survived two full-capacity derby nights without a false lockdown. Raising the anomaly threshold weakens tailgate detection, so change it deliberately. Current defaults are listed below.

tuning constants:
QUOTAS = {
    "druwyn": 5,
    "holix": 5,
    "zorath": 5,
    "holwyn": 10,
}